Output 6aea0eb17612337bd33505f84e6914876b4e88b5690303a24fca4d2c420b7299:27

value
757438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a502d6739b90bd654b97bd069d6dc29c97b41b1 OP_EQUAL
address
3HDYqyXBmxLZf3QRps5PS9Q4tXbo8PJuuC
transaction
6aea0eb17612337bd33505f84e6914876b4e88b5690303a24fca4d2c420b7299
spent
true